    Operation Adjusting the volume ☞ Press the VOL– or VOL+ button on the TFT monitor to adjust the volume. ✎ If the button is held down, the volume changes continuously. When setting the volume, please make sure that traffic noises (horns, sirens, emergency vehi- cles, etc.) are still audible.

    Operation Video during driving For reasons of driving safety, video images are only displayed on the TFT monitor of the mul- timedia system following selection of one of the video sources (“AUX-IN”, “DVD”, etc.) when the hand brake is applied. Reversing camera If a reversing camera is connected to the multimedia system, the image from the reversing camera appears on the TFT monitor when reverse gear is engaged.

    Installation instructions IMPORTANT INFORMATION Only trained personnel may install the unit! Observe automotive industry quality standards! Fire hazard. When drilling, take care not to damage concealed wiring harnesses, the fuel tank or fuel lines! Never drill into supporting or safety-relevant body parts! Only install the unit in vehicles with a 12-V on-board voltage and negative pole on the vehicle body.
